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Bugünün blogu için inanılmaz heyecanlıyım çünkü şu anda LuckyTemplates'daki en kötü özelliğin nasıl aniden en iyi özelliğe dönüşeceğini gösterecek. Tabular Editor LuckyTemplates'dan bahsediyorum. Bu eğitimin tam videosunu bu blogun alt kısmından izleyebilirsiniz.

Aralık 2020'de Tabular Editor 3'ün önizleme sürümünü deneyecek ve beta programına girecek kadar şanslıydım. Son birkaç aydır her gün kullanıyorum ve LuckyTemplates'ı kullanma biçimimde gerçekten devrim yarattı. Bugün biraz zaman ayırıp Tabular Editor LuckyTemplates sürüm 3'ün (TE3) temel özelliklerinde size yol göstermek istiyorum. LuckyTemplates'ı kullanma şeklinizi de gerçekten değiştireceğini düşündüğümü size göstereceğim.

İçindekiler

Tablo Düzenleyici LuckyTemplates Sürüm 3 Özellikleri ve İşlevleri

İşte TE3'ün gerçekten çok faydalı ve oldukça şaşırtıcı bulduğum temel özelliklerinden bazıları.

yapılandırılabilirlik

Ele almak istediğim şeylerden biri yapılandırma. Burada Tabular Editor 3'te görebileceğiniz gibi, birden fazla penceremiz var ve bunların tümü tamamen yapılandırılabilir . Eşyaları hareket ettirebilirsin. Öğeleri gerçekten sezgisel bir şekilde çıkarabilir ve yeni bölümler geliştirebilirsiniz. Onları da yeniden boyutlandırabilirsiniz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Bunu ayrıca Capture Workspaces'e kaydedebilir ve ardından bunları kullanılabilir Workspaces listesine kaydedebilirsiniz .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Örneğin, arama ve değiştirme yaptığınız Best Practice Analyzer'da çalışıyorsunuz, hesaplamaları düzenliyorsanız farklı bir çalışma alanına açabilirsiniz. Bunu inanılmaz derecede faydalı buldum.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ayrıca bir dizi farklı temaya sahiptir . Karanlık mod hayranıysanız, doğrudan karanlık moda geçebilirsiniz. Mavi olanı beğendim, sadece kişisel bir tercih.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Tüm araç çubukları yapılandırılabilir. Menüler yapılandırılabilir. Bunu tam olarak istediğiniz şekilde çalıştırabilir ve çalışırken kendinizi rahat hissedebilirsiniz. LuckyTemplates'da DAX yazmak için harcadığınız süre düşünüldüğünde bunun oldukça önemli olduğunu düşünüyorum.

DAX Yazma

Konuşmak istediğim bir sonraki konu, TE3 IntelliSense'in DAX'inizi yazarken size nasıl yardımcı olduğu . Buraya yeni bir önlem almak için geldiğimde ve biraz DAX yazmaya başladığımda, bunun nasıl gerçek bir gelişme olduğunu hemen göreceksiniz.

Burada bazı güzel küçük özellikler var. Örneğin, kontrol (ctrl), enter veya shift enter hakkında endişelenmenize gerek yok. Sadece enter tuşuna basarsınız ve sizi bir sonraki satıra götürür. Ve sonra F5, kodunuzu işleyecek olan şeydir.

Burada standart IntelliSense'i ve bazı ek bilgileri görebilirsiniz. Bağlam geçiş modunda olduğumuzu söylüyor. Ayrıca bir hotlink'e sahiptir.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Böylece, işlevle ilgili ek bilgi için sizi doğrudan DAX Kılavuzuna götüren bağlantıya tıklayabilirsiniz .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

İçinde yerleşik çok sayıda arka plan yeteneği ve bilgisi vardır. Yarasadan hemen görmeye başladığınız gerçekten net şeylerden biri, hata mesajları açısından TE3'ün tüm hataları alacağıdır.

Burada Analysis Services altında görebileceğiniz gibi, normal DAX Düzenleyicisi bu hatalardan yalnızca birini alacaktır. Öte yandan Tabular Editor 3, DAX için Semantik İşlemci denen şeye sahiptir ve tüm hataları toplayacaktır.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Bu size bu hatalar hakkında çok daha fazla bilgi verecektir. çok az bağımsız değişkenin iletildiğini ve bağımsız değişken için minimum sayının ne olduğunu söyler , ancak bu hatanın nerede olduğunu bilmez.

Semantik İşlemci ise üçüncü satırda (3), dokuzuncu sütunda (9) olduğunu bilir ve size tam olarak nereden başladığını söyler. Size hatayı açıklamak için bir araç ipucu verir ve size ifadede bulduğu tüm hataları verir. Hata ayıklama açısından size gerçekten yardımcı olur.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Soğuk Katlama, DAX Hata Ayıklama ve DAX Komut Dosyası Oluşturma

Bir başka gerçekten güzel özellik de, değişkenlerinizi daraltabileceğiniz ve ölçümünüzün nasıl göründüğüne dair genel olarak daha iyi bir resim elde edebileceğiniz, soğuk katlama adı verilen bu şeydir . Bu, özellikle ekranın ötesine geçen uzun ölçüler yazıyorsanız gerçekten yararlıdır.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ölçü dallandırma hata ayıklaması için de iyi çalışır. Örneğin, burada Toplam Müşteriler'e bakarsanız ve bu ölçüme sağ tıklarsanız, Bağımlılıkları Göster yazacaktır .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Hangi nesnelerin Toplam Müşteriye bağlı olduğunu ve hangi nesnelere bağlı olduğunu size gösterecektir. Ve böylece yapabileceğiniz şey, DAX komut dosyası oluşturma adı verilen bir şeydir . Bu, ölçü dallandırmamıza bakmanın gerçekten ilginç bir yolu.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Örneğin, bu Dilimleyici Hasat ölçülerini ve Menzildeki Toplam Müşteri ölçülerimizi alalım. Bu gruplamaya tıklarsak, Script DAX adlı bir seçenek görürüz . Buna tıklıyoruz ve tüm ölçümlerimizi tek bir yerde içeren bir komut dosyası oluşturuyor. Bunu düzenleyebiliriz. Tedbirlerin birbirinden nasıl ayrıldığına bakabiliriz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ayrıca, bu sonucu refactor etmek istersek VAR Result adını değiştirebiliriz. Ve yapacağı şey, kapsamı içinde yeniden adlandırmak olacaktır .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Bu sonuçların her ikisini de altta etiketler ve bunları Outcome olarak değiştirebiliriz . Şimdi bunu kodda değiştirdik, ancak formülün üst kısmında, farklı bir ölçümde de Sonuç'un olduğu yerde, bunu kapsam dışında tutacak kadar biliyordu. Tüm bu Sonuçları gözden geçirecek ve değiştirecek olan ortalama ara ve değiştir işleminizden çok daha akıllıdır.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Oradan, Bul ve değiştir penceresini açabilirsiniz . Çalışma alanı işlevselliği aracılığıyla, bunun için bir pencere oluşturabilir ve ardından bunu burada inceleyebilir ve tek ölçü versiyonunda herhangi bir durum eşleştirme veya tam kelime eşleştirme, tümünü bulma, öncekini bulma, bunu aşağı düzenleme vb. yapabiliriz. veya komut dosyası sürümü. Kontrol S'ye basın ve bunu LuckyTemplates modeline geri kaydeder.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ayrıca, DAX'imiz için yerleşik bir biçimlendirmemiz var , böylece betiği de biçimlendirebiliriz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Önizlemeler, Pivot Izgaralar ve Veri Sorgulama

Burada yapabileceğimiz birkaç şey daha var. Tablolarımıza bakmak istiyorsak, tablodaki alanların her birine bakarak basit bir önizleme yapabiliriz .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

İnceleme için sağ taraftaki bilgi sütununu da açabiliriz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Yapabileceğimiz diğer şey Pivot Grid . Bu temelde Excel'deki bir pivot tablonun veya LuckyTemplates'daki bir matrisin eşdeğeridir. Matris görseline oldukça benzer bir şey. Değişkenleri tabloya sürükleyip bırakmanız yeterlidir.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Sonuçlarımızı doğrulamak için bunu kullanabiliriz. Satır toplamlarını ve sütun toplamlarını çalıştırır. Aslında fiziksel olarak modelde bulunan bir grup dış tablo oluşturmaktan çok daha kolaydır.

Burada başka bir büyük özellik daha var, o da DAX Sorgusu . DAX Studio'da çalışıyorsanız, buna çok aşina olacaksınız. Burada tabloları gerçekleştirebiliriz.

işlevini ele alalım ve onu analiz etmek istiyoruz, onu bir sorguya koyabiliriz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Sorguların her zaman DEĞERLENDİR ile başladığını ve ardından bu ölçüyü buraya yapıştırdığımızı unutmayın. Bu, hata ayıklama için gerçekten harika bir işlevdir.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Komut Dosyası Oluşturma ve Makro Kayıt

Ele almak istediğim bir sonraki şey komut dosyası yazmak. Burada, Tabular Editor 3'teki otomatik komut dosyası oluşturma özelliğini size göstermek istiyorum. Buraya bazı temel kodlar yazabilir veya bazı ölçüleri kopyalayıp yapıştırabiliriz .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ardından, Makro Olarak Kaydet'e basmanız yeterlidir .

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Bu makroları uygulamak için model, tablo veya sütun gibi uygun kapsama gitmeniz yeterlidir. Ardından, sağ tıklayın ve ardından Makrolar'ı seçin ; bundan sonra, uygun komut dosyasını uygulamanız yeterlidir.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ve böylece, örneğin tüm DAX'ı biçimlendirirsek , bu, DAX biçimini kullanarak veya uzun satır mı yoksa kısa satır mı seçtiğimize bağlı olarak tüm DAX'imizi biçimlendirir. Bunu LuckyTemplates dosyasına geri kaydetmek için S kontrolüne basarız.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Son olarak, TE3'te Makro Kaydedici vardır, burada bunu açabilir, otomatikleştirmek istediğiniz işlevi gerçekleştirebilir ve ardından, kendi başınıza çok fazla kodlama bilmeden o komut dosyasını oluşturmak için oluşturduğu kodu kullanabilirsiniz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Tablo Düzenleyicisi LuckyTemplates Best Practice Analyzer

TE3'teki gerçekten harika şeylerden biri , en iyi uygulama kural setine sahip olmasıdır . Şimdi Best Practice Analyzer'ı açalım . Yerel kullanıcı için kuralları, Geçerli model için kuralları ve Yerel makine için kuralları vardır. Bunu da ekleyelim ve ardından Include Rule file from URL diyebiliriz . Ardından Analyst Hub'dan bir URL yapıştırıyoruz.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Ardından, en iyi uygulamalar için bir dizi kural açar.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Daha sonra çalıştır'a basabilirsiniz ve o betiği çalıştıracak, modelinizde değişiklikler yapacak ve en iyi uygulamayı uygulayacaktır.

Tablo Düzenleyici LuckyTemplates: Sürüm 3 İncelemesi ve Eğitimi

Bu, veri modellemenizi otomatik olarak, kural kural, tablo tablo gözden geçirerek ve en iyi uygulamalara uymadığınız alanları vurgulayarak iyileştirmenin harika bir yoludur.


LuckyTemplates'da Hesaplama Grupları Oluşturmak İçin Tablo Düzenleyiciyi Kullanma
LuckyTemplates Desktop'ta DAX Studio Nedir
LuckyTemplates'da Harici Araçlar Menünüzün Düzeyini Yükseltin

Çözüm

Bu, Tablo Düzenleyici LuckyTemplates sürüm 3'te çok hızlı bir tur. Burada ele almadığımız daha birçok işlev var. Bazı veri modelleme özelliklerimiz var, böylece veri modellerinizi çizebilir ve ilişkilerinizle çalışabilirsiniz. M kodunuza vs. gerçekten bakabileceğiniz bölümler vardır.

Burada inanılmaz bir dizi özellik var ve biz burada sadece yüzeyi çiziyoruz. Ancak umarım, bunun DAX yazma, DAX hatalarını ayıklama ve veri modellerinizi iyileştirme açısından size nasıl genişletilmiş işlevsellik ve muazzam yetenek sağladığını gerçekten görebilirsiniz . Ayrıca ölçüleriniz ve tablolarınızda neler olup bittiğine dair genel anlayışınızı geliştirmenize yardımcı olacaktır. İnanılmaz derecede yetenekli programcı Daniel sayesinde.

Umarım bu bilgi size onu test etmek için biraz cesaret verir. Ne düşündüğünüzü görün ve bunun LuckyTemplates kullanma şeklinizi nasıl değiştirdiğini görün.

Herşey gönlünce olsun!

Leave a Comment

Excel Hücrelerini Metne Sığdırma: 4 Kolay Çözüm

Excel Hücrelerini Metne Sığdırma: 4 Kolay Çözüm

Excel hücrelerini metne sığdırmak için güncel bilgileri ve 4 kolay çözümü keşfedin.

Bir Excel Dosyasının Boyutu Nasıl Küçültülür – 6 Etkili Yöntem

Bir Excel Dosyasının Boyutu Nasıl Küçültülür – 6 Etkili Yöntem

Bir Excel Dosyasının Boyutunu Küçültmek için 6 Etkili Yöntem. Hızlı ve kolay yöntemler ile verilerinizi kaybetmeden yer açın.

Pythonda Self Nedir: Gerçek Dünyadan Örnekler

Pythonda Self Nedir: Gerçek Dünyadan Örnekler

Python'da Self Nedir: Gerçek Dünyadan Örnekler

Rde Bir RDS Dosyası Nasıl Kaydedilir ve Yüklenir

Rde Bir RDS Dosyası Nasıl Kaydedilir ve Yüklenir

R'de bir .rds dosyasındaki nesneleri nasıl kaydedeceğinizi ve yükleyeceğinizi öğreneceksiniz. Bu blog aynı zamanda R'den LuckyTemplates'a nesnelerin nasıl içe aktarılacağını da ele alacaktır.

İlk N İş Günü Tekrar Ziyaret Edildi – Bir DAX Kodlama Dili Çözümü

İlk N İş Günü Tekrar Ziyaret Edildi – Bir DAX Kodlama Dili Çözümü

Bu DAX kodlama dili eğitiminde, GENERATE işlevinin nasıl kullanılacağını ve bir ölçü başlığının dinamik olarak nasıl değiştirileceğini öğrenin.

LuckyTemplatesda Çok İş Parçacıklı Dinamik Görsel Tekniği Kullanarak Öngörüleri Sergileyin

LuckyTemplatesda Çok İş Parçacıklı Dinamik Görsel Tekniği Kullanarak Öngörüleri Sergileyin

Bu eğitici, raporlarınızdaki dinamik veri görselleştirmelerinden içgörüler oluşturmak için Çok Kanallı Dinamik Görseller tekniğinin nasıl kullanılacağını kapsayacaktır.

LuckyTemplatesda İçeriği Filtrelemeye Giriş

LuckyTemplatesda İçeriği Filtrelemeye Giriş

Bu yazıda, filtre bağlamından geçeceğim. Filtre bağlamı, herhangi bir LuckyTemplates kullanıcısının başlangıçta öğrenmesi gereken en önemli konulardan biridir.

LuckyTemplates Çevrimiçi Hizmetindeki Uygulamaları Kullanmak İçin En İyi İpuçları

LuckyTemplates Çevrimiçi Hizmetindeki Uygulamaları Kullanmak İçin En İyi İpuçları

LuckyTemplates Apps çevrimiçi hizmetinin çeşitli kaynaklardan oluşturulan farklı raporların ve içgörülerin yönetilmesine nasıl yardımcı olabileceğini göstermek istiyorum.

Fazla Mesai Kâr Marjı Değişikliklerini Analiz Edin - LuckyTemplates ve DAX ile Analitik

Fazla Mesai Kâr Marjı Değişikliklerini Analiz Edin - LuckyTemplates ve DAX ile Analitik

LuckyTemplates'da ölçü dallandırma ve DAX formüllerini birleştirme gibi teknikleri kullanarak kâr marjı değişikliklerinizi nasıl hesaplayacağınızı öğrenin.

DAX Studioda Veri Önbellekleri İçin Materyalleştirme Fikirleri

DAX Studioda Veri Önbellekleri İçin Materyalleştirme Fikirleri

Bu öğreticide, veri önbelleklerini gerçekleştirme fikirleri ve bunların DAX'ın sonuç sağlama performansını nasıl etkilediği tartışılacaktır.